ðŠģ Rodent Removal
Rodents are one of the main food sources for snakes, so removing them significantly decreases snake activity around your property. Experts use traps, bait stations, and sealing techniques to cut off access and eliminate nesting zones.
ðŋ Brush and Yard Clearing
Overgrown vegetation and debris attract snakes by providing shelter and prey. Yard clearing services focus on trimming, removing piles of leaves or wood, and cleaning up areas where snakes might nest or hide.
ðïļ Crawl Space Exclusion
Professionals inspect crawl spaces for entry points and seal cracks or gaps to keep snakes and other pests out. They may also install mesh barriers or special vents to allow airflow without providing entry access.
ð§Ŋ Snake Repellent Application
Non-toxic repellents are available to create a barrier around your home or structures. These are especially useful for properties near water, forests, or open fields where snakes are more common.
ð§ Home Sealing Services
Sealing around doors, vents, foundations, and utility lines is essential to prevent snake entry. A complete sealing service includes inspection, caulking, and applying weather-resistant barriers to common entry points.
ðŠĪ Wildlife Trapping & Relocation
When snakes or other animals are already present, humane trapping ensures safe removal without harming the creatures. Relocation follows wildlife laws and ensures your property remains undisturbed.
